The Mumbai Metropolitan Region (MMR) has achieved a significant milestone by inaugurating partial stretches of metro lines 2B and 9, bringing its operational metro network to 101 km. This development positions MMR as the second-largest metro network in India, following the 416 km Delhi Metro.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is expressed ambitions to expand the metro network to a fully integrated 337 km system. Additionally, a new pod taxi project was announced, which will feature an 8.85 km network with driverless pods capable of carrying six passengers. The first phase of this project is set to be completed within 20 months. Furthermore, the Thane-Borivali Twin Tunnel project will significantly reduce travel time between these two locations from 90 minutes to just 15 minutes, catering to an estimated 80,000 vehicles by 2029.
